Offline Marketing Manager - French speaking (m/f/d)
Offline Marketing Manager - French speaking (m/f/d)

Offline Marketing Manager - French speaking (m/f/d)

London Full-Time No home office possible
T

Social network you want to login/join with:

Offline Marketing Manager – French speaking (m/f/d), London

Client:

DCMN

Location:

London, United Kingdom

Job Category:

Other

EU work permit required:

Yes

Job Reference:

e8d4ba380716

Job Views:

10

Posted:

26.04.2025

Expiry Date:

10.06.2025

Job Description:

You will be working in a bilingual environment requiring fluency in French and English; German skills are a plus.

How you will make an impact:

  • Effectively communicate and convey our vision and philosophy to potential new clients and stakeholders.
  • Take full responsibility for assigned clients and their offline marketing campaigns, primarily performance-driven TV campaigns, as well as OOH, Radio, etc.
  • Advise digital commerce companies on opportunities to scale their business through data-driven and intelligent marketing campaigns.
  • Plan, buy, control, and optimize clients’ international offline marketing campaigns, with a focus on TV.
  • Analyze and interpret campaign results, explain them to clients, and discuss results at an advanced level.
  • Prepare clear campaign reports based on proprietary TV attribution tools and third-party tools.
  • Build strong, long-term relationships with international clients.
  • Support and train Junior Marketing Managers and share best practices with offline marketing specialists outside the team.

Skills needed to succeed:

  • At least 2 years of experience in offline marketing for digital brands or DRTV.
  • Strong knowledge of the French media market, including TV audience measurement, saleshouses, planning, and buying.
  • Excellent analytical skills and proficiency with numbers and Excel.
  • Experience with French planning tools such as Popcorn or Peaktime.
  • Experience with competitor analysis tools like Kantar or Medialand.
  • Good negotiation skills are a plus.
  • Entrepreneurial, proactive, and hands-on attitude.
  • Experience working within startups or in marketing for digital brands is advantageous.
  • Understanding of short-, mid-, and long-term campaign impacts and relevant KPIs.
  • Efficient and results-oriented work style.

#J-18808-Ljbffr

T

Contact Detail:

TN United Kingdom Recruiting Team

Offline Marketing Manager - French speaking (m/f/d)
TN United Kingdom
T
  • Offline Marketing Manager - French speaking (m/f/d)

    London
    Full-Time

    Application deadline: 2027-06-12

  • T

    TN United Kingdom

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>